Hey guys I have a driveline question. I just installed a small lift on my 97 XJ . ZJ front springs with 1"3/4" spacer up front and two inch lift blocks in the back. Now I think I have some vibration from the rear end. I did one side at a time so the rear pinion angle didn't change . I think I need to adjust the pinion up a few degrees but I'm not sure. let me know wut you guys think
